Nickel: Towards Modular Modeling and Simulation of Production Control Systems3/15 Production Control System (PCS) oFlexible distributed control is complex to build oFrequent adaptation to new requirements or changes in the topology are required oProgramming languages (Ada, C, …) oTest & code corrections in the production environment oDesign and maintenance Methodology & UML oAvoid long downtimes oVerification is hard problem Simulation

Nickel: Towards Modular Modeling and Simulation of Production Control Systems7/15 Classes & Simulation Simulation result: oCan detect coordination problems: deadlock, … oProvides insight into system dynamics (tinkering style) Limitations: oSystem has to be complete (closed) oObservations do only hold for very restricted form of subclass refinement

Nickel: Towards Modular Modeling and Simulation of Production Control Systems8/15 Modularity : Overall Synchronization Component Spec.: ooverall behavior oarbitrary structures Abstraction: ocombine processes obuild abstract process obehavior for layer C depends on (A || B) ono abstraction barrier for used layers Limitations: oState explosion problem (propability for error detection) oComponent exchange preserve results only when very restricted conformance realtion holds A B C Layer C
